To make your own Songspot widget you can
click on "Get your own Songspot" on my widget
sign in
select "find music"
choose a song and click the "add to playlist" icon
choose the "create a new playlist" option
click "add and go to playlist"
click "make a widget with this playlist"
a "New Songspot" page will come up, and then you click the dropdown menu for "Target Website" and select the appropriate blog server
enter the exact page address where you want the widget
select the vertical layout (for blogger)
then under "select option" check the "Start the music automatically" box.
And that's it. Go to your page and it'll be there. I know that's detailed, but I didn't really know how else to do it. Plus, I've had others ask me the same question and now it's done and all I have to do is refer them to this comment. :D
